HIP 81727

HIP 81727 is a A-type (White) star located in the constellation Scorpius.

At a distance of roughly 2,346 light-years, HIP 81727 is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 81727 is classified as a spectral class A star (A-type (White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 81727 has an apparent magnitude of +8.97,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its blue-white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.089.
